Webhook delivery in Relayforge retries failed sends up to six times with exponential backoff, starting at 30 seconds and capping at one hour. A delivery is considered failed on any non-2xx response or a timeout beyond 10 seconds. After the final attempt, the event moves to the dead-letter table for manual replay. Retry state is tracked per-endpoint, not per-event, so a flapping endpoint pauses its whole queue. The dead-letter table lives in the primary delivery database, reachable via the connection string below.

primary connection of tajeg-tajop = postgresql://julax_svc:DI@db-e7f3.kelvidyn.corp:5432/rusdor

- [ ] **Step 7: Breaker override escrow.** After sealing the signing keys for the Tallgrove upstream API circuit breaker, confirm the support team can force the breaker open during a full outage. The override bundle lives in the sealed escrow drawer and is useless without its unlock phrase. Two ceremony witnesses must initial this step before proceeding. The escrow bundle is decrypted with the recovery passphrase that follows.

vault phrase of kahip-kahop = holath-quenmir

Welcome to reviewing Sproutline, our plant-watering scheduler. Core logic lives in the cadence module; moisture thresholds are config-driven, never hardcoded. Reject any PR that bypasses the dry-run simulator, since a bad schedule can flood the greenhouse beds at the Fernholt site. Tests must cover timezone rollover. Review conventions and the approval checklist are documented on the internal page below.

operations page: https://jenkins.zemvarcloud.local/job/merge_requests/repo/build/73930b4b30f0a8ed

/*
 * RestockPilot client setup — for external plugin authors.
 * This client talks to the Corridor restock-planning API: it pulls
 * machine inventory snapshots, predicts sell-through, and returns a
 * suggested restock route. Plugins must call init() before any
 * planner methods. Rate limit: 60 req/min per plugin. Sandbox data
 * only; production machines are off-limits. Initialize the client
 * with the key below.
 */

API key for bahop-yajog: qvz3-mhf